The Specialized Equipment
Tow trucks designed for heavy duty towing are equipped with powerful winches and reinforced frames, allowing them to handle vehicles weighing several tons. Additionally, they often come with extended wheel lifts or underlifts that can securely grip larger vehicles. This specialized equipment ensures that heavy-duty towing is executed safely and efficiently.
Weight Limits and Classifications
It's crucial to be aware of weight limits and classifications when considering towing heavy duty vehicles. Tow trucks are classified based on their towing capacity, typically measured in tons. Light-duty tow trucks can handle vehicles up to 10,000 pounds, while medium-duty ones can handle up to 26,000 pounds. Heavy duty tow trucks, on the other hand, are designed to tow vehicles that weigh over 26,000 pounds. This category encompasses a wide range of vehicles, including large commercial trucks and buses.

Safety Precautions
Safety should always be the top priority when it comes to towing heavy duty vehicles. Properly securing the load, using safety chains, and following recommended towing procedures are critical steps.
